Output 62f66e010ab23a05d94b2ee7ac30f72dc2a87518344e8b54801b1fb1743c5c86:1

value
18943744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2758e0c9a571eb03b03836e229debcb408c6c247 OP_EQUAL
address
35H4kP7v8igDfzfoYmGMtLb9wojBJh4UiS
transaction
62f66e010ab23a05d94b2ee7ac30f72dc2a87518344e8b54801b1fb1743c5c86
spent
true